Understanding the Coleman 200 Mini Bike

The Coleman 200 Mini Bike is a compact, gas-powered bike designed for fun rides around the neighborhood, trails, or campsites. It’s known for its sturdy build and easy handling, making it a great choice for beginners and casual riders like me.

Key Features I Looked For

  • Engine Power: The 200 Mini Bike comes with a 196cc engine, which provides enough power for smooth rides without being overwhelming. I found this perfect for both kids (teens) and adults who want a bit of adventure.
  • Frame and Build Quality: Its steel frame gave me confidence in its durability. I wanted a bike that could handle rough surfaces and last for years.
  • Ease of Use: The bike has a simple push-button start and straightforward controls, which made it easy for me to operate right away.
  • Tire Size and Suspension: The 8-inch pneumatic tires provide good traction and cushioning. While it doesn’t have advanced suspension, the tires absorb most bumps on dirt or pavement.
  • Weight and Portability: At around 120 pounds, it’s not too heavy for one person to handle but still feels solid when riding. I appreciated that it’s compact enough to transport in a truck bed or trailer.

What to Consider Before Buying

  • Intended Use: I asked myself where I’d be riding most—around the yard, trails, or flat pavement. The Coleman 200 Mini Bike is great for casual off-road fun but not suited for extreme terrain or high speeds.
  • Safety Gear: Since the bike can reach speeds up to about 20 mph, I made sure to get a good helmet, gloves, and protective gear to stay safe.
  • Maintenance Needs: Like any gas-powered bike, it requires regular maintenance such as oil changes and air filter cleaning. I was ready to invest some time in upkeep to keep it running smoothly.
  • Size and Comfort: I checked the seat height and handlebar position to ensure a comfortable ride. The adjustable seat helped me find the right fit.
  • Budget: The Coleman 200 Mini Bike offers good value for its price, but I compared prices online and in stores to get the best deal.
